Meet Ashro Woman of the Week, Evelyn from California
“Life is precious…take nothing for granted.”
Evelyn practices what she preaches—cherishing her family, living out her faith, and showcasing her flawlessly coordinated fashion. “My grandmother influenced my style as a little girl. I was very dainty and it has remained in my upbringing,” she says. She also describes the Ashro woman as classy and notes that she embodies her with grace.
Evelyn spends her free time event planning and decorating and most importanly spending time with the smallest things that matter the most to her, which is enjoying her family. She is also sorority member to the Delta Theta Sigma.
A woman of deep faith, Evelyn is a true believer in God. She shares that she is passing along her faith traditions and spiritual journey to her children and grandchildren each and every day. “Self-preservation begins with accountability—own your actions,” says Evelyn, leaving us with her best advice.
